Manuel Turizo – Biography

Manuel Turizo Zapata, born on April 12, 2000, in Monteria, Colombia, under the fire sign of Aries, is a 19-year-old Colombian rapper, singer, multi-instrumentalist, and composer who has recently become one of the world’s most popular reggaeton performers. He rose to prominence in 2016 with the singles “Vamonos” and “Baila Conmigo,” which were released independently and completely by his brother. With the release of “Una Lady Como T” in 2017, he attained superstardom, charting near the top in various nations. The song’s success landed him a deal with Sony Music and a North and Central American tour with Puerto Rican trap and reggaeton sensation Ozuna. He has since become one of the most well-known figures in the ever-changing Latin music scene.

Manuel Turizo – Birth, Age, Ethnicity, Siblings, Education

Manuel grew raised in a family where music was an important element of everyday life. His mother and father were both musicians, and his older brother began making beats and singing as a teenager. As a result, Turizo was exposed to artistic influences from the time he was a toddler. ‘Music was sort of a mandatory thing in my household,’ Manuel says, laughing. ‘There wasn’t a single minute of silence, but I liked it.’ He learned to play various musical instruments while still in preschool, including the piano, guitar, ukulele, and even the saxophone. For most of his childhood, he didn’t even consider being a musician — he loved animals and aspired to be a doctor.

It wasn’t until his brother Julian persuaded him to take singing classes that Manuel became obsessed with using his vocal cords as a musical instrument and never looked back. He wasn’t willing to forsake his education, so he enrolled in online classes in an unidentified field. This provided him with more time to concentrate on his music.

Manuel Turizo – Professional Career

Manuel, unlike other budding artists, was not eager to release songs simply to publish them. Instead, he wanted to be completely secure in his voice abilities before releasing his work to the public. In 201, he released two singles, “Vamonos” and “Baila Conmigo,” both produced by his older brother, Julian Turizo. Both tunes instantly went viral, piqued the interest of promoters and journalists in the 16-year-old reggaeton phenomenon.

He briefly toured Colombia and northern South America, where he was blown away by the attendance at each of his gigs, and the supporters’ enthusiasm inspired him to strive even more. He also promoted his work quite effectively through social media. Turizo released “Una Lady Como T” on March 17, 2017, a classically-sounding song with a modern, lively rhythm. In barely two months, the song dominated YouTube’s Trending section, with 300 million views. The music has 1.3 billion views as of August 2019, which is unheard of for an independent artist. He appeared on the Latin Pop Songs charts, MTV, and set multiple streaming records.

A Rising Star: Signing a Contract and Touring with Ozuna

With three successful songs under his belt, Manuel demonstrated that his accomplishments were far more than a lucky break. He signed with La Industria Inc. and Sony Music, their distributing partner. By this point, “Una Lady Como T” had climbed to the top 40 of the Hot Latin Songs chart and was steadily climbing. Ozuna, a Puerto Rican trap and reggaeton musician, adored Manuel’s songs and offered him to be his opening act for a tour throughout South and Central America. Turizo was able to garner new fans and get to the top tier of Latin artists in the 2010s as a result of this. He and Ozuna performed at over 30 sold-out events, bringing flair and emotion to the stage.

Recent Creations

Also in 2017, Manuel collaborated with fellow reggaeton star Valentino on the song “Besame,” which gained widespread airplay and exploded onto the scene with over 50 million views in the first few weeks. He gave his fans another success at the end of the year, this time a remix of “Una Lady Como T” with Nicky Jam. Unlike his prior singles, this one was a huge hit in the United States, prompting a tour with Sebastian Yarra in early 2018. Following his return from this series of concerts, Manuel collaborated with vocalist Sebastian to record numerous tunes, most of which remain unreleased. The following year, he ruled the charts with hits like “Desconocidos” featuring Mau y Ricky and Camilo.

He continued his excellent form in 2019 with a range of songs and collaborations, the finest of which being “Dile la Verdad” ft. Jowell and “Esclavo de Tus Besos” with good friend and mentor Ozuna. Manuel is currently working on his debut album as of August 2019.

Why is Manuel Turizo so well-liked?

Manuel Turizo rose to prominence as one of the world’s most popular Latin artists while still in his teens. What is the reason for this? His musical background is the fundamental cause for his omnipresence on websites, top charts, and in magazines. Turizo, a multi-instrumentalist, has combined reggaeton with classic rock, folk, and trap elements. He’s also worked with artists from a variety of genres, which has allowed him to broaden his voice.

Critics believe his fame stems from his astute marketing skills, which allow him to appeal to a wide range of groups. Manuel identifies his music as “urban,” saying, “My genre is urban, it’s a struggle because it’s a genre that’s defined as empty, meaningless letters; for me, that’s not music.” For me, it’s telling a tale with music.’
